Output 18896fa30744607c82ca03e7d1fb50d1eac4dfd4aa22d7459e52821d34851f1f:0

value
1498905
script pubkey
OP_0 OP_PUSHBYTES_20 2db6c3b87efe770c7e42b1e36742d77f156f80ce
address
bc1q9kmv8wr7lemscljzk83kwskh0u2klqxwch0f26
transaction
18896fa30744607c82ca03e7d1fb50d1eac4dfd4aa22d7459e52821d34851f1f
confirmations
45828
spent
true